The Bachelor of Fine Arts in Dance emphasizes modern dance technique, performance, choreography, and dance theory. The Bachelor of Fine Arts in Dance at Temple is focused on building well-rounded, versatile artists who are not only technically proficient, but have a broad range and a deep understanding of their work. The B.F.A. program focuses on modern dance technique and choreography, but with a broad curriculum that includes requirements in ballet, which follows the AMERICAN BALLET THEATRE National Training Curriculum, African dance and other technique electives. Other course requirements include composition, repertory, creative process, improvisation, and dance science, in addition to courses that explore cultural, historical and analytical approaches to the study of dance. Full accredited Member of the National Association of Schools of Dance (NASD). The degree program in dance aims to: Guide students toward a balance of cognitive, analytic, intuitive, and creative skills. Aid students in development of their creative potential through technique, choreography, performance, research, and other creative media. Educate students about the various forms and purposes of dance within their historical, social, and cultural contexts. Provide intensive training in a range of dance techniques and styles as represented by the faculty and selected guest artists. Prepare students for professional careers as performing artists, choreographers, teachers, scholars, and informed and responsible leaders in academic and other professional settings.
